Lexicology

Lexicology is a speciality in linguistics dealing with the meaning and usage of words, as conceived in a dictionary or thesaurus. The term first appeared in the 1820's, though obviously there were lexicologists before that.

As there are many different types of dictionaries, there are many different types of lexicologists. There are difficulties is working out what simple words such as 'the' mean, and what complicated words mean. Also which words to keep in and which not to include.
